20096-53-1 Usage

Description

2,6-ANS, also known as 2-(4-aminophenyl)-6-methoxybenzothiazole, is a fluorescent dye widely utilized in biochemical and biophysical research. It is recognized for its capacity to bind to the hydrophobic regions of proteins and membranes, which renders it an advantageous tool for investigating protein-protein interactions, protein folding, and membrane dynamics. Furthermore, 2,6-ANS has been employed in the characterization of amyloid fibrils and aggregates, exhibiting potential for diagnosing amyloid-related diseases. Its fluorescent characteristics and specificity for hydrophobic binding sites make it a valuable asset in research areas concerning protein and membrane biology.
Uses in Biochemical and Biophysical Research:
2,6-ANS is used as a fluorescent probe for studying protein-protein interactions and protein folding due to its ability to bind to hydrophobic pockets in proteins and membranes.
Used in the Characterization of Amyloid Fibril and Aggregates:
2,6-ANS is used as a diagnostic tool for amyloid-related diseases, as it can bind to and characterize amyloid fibrils and aggregates, aiding in the detection and study of these conditions.
Used in Membrane Dynamics Studies:
2,6-ANS is used as a fluorescent marker for analyzing membrane dynamics, given its propensity to interact with the hydrophobic regions of biological membranes.

Check Digit Verification of cas no

The CAS Registry Mumber 20096-53-1 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 2,0,0,9 and 6 respectively; the second part has 2 digits, 5 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 20096-53:
(7*2)+(6*0)+(5*0)+(4*9)+(3*6)+(2*5)+(1*3)=81
81 % 10 = 1
So 20096-53-1 is a valid CAS Registry Number.
